5.3.4 Thermal Metrology
The maximum TTV case temperatures (T
CASE-MAX
) can be derived from the data in the
appropriate TTV thermal profile earlier in this chapter. The TTV T
CASE
is measured at the
geometric top center of the TTV integrated heat spreader (IHS). Figure 5-5 illustrates
the location where T
CASE
temperature measurements should be made.

5.3.5 Fan Speed Control Scheme with Digital Thermal Sensor
(DTS) 1.1
To correctly use DTS 1.1, the designer must first select a worst case scenario T
AMBIENT
,
and ensure that the Fan Speed Control (FSC) can provide a Ψ
CA
that is equivalent or
greater than the Ψ
CA
specification.
The DTS 1.1 implementation consists of two points: a Ψ
CA
at T
CONTROL
and a Ψ
CA
at
DTS = -1.
The Ψ
CA
point at DTS = -1 defines the minimum Ψ
CA
required at TDP considering the
worst case system design T
AMBIENT
design point:
Ψ
CA
= (T
CASE-MAX
– T
AMBIENT-TARGET
) / TDP
For example, for a 91 W TDP part, the T
CASE
maximum is 63.7 °C and at a worst case
design point of 40 °C local ambient this will result in:
Ψ
CA
= (63.7 – 40) / 91 = 0.26 °C/W
